About the Opportunity

Lyra’s provider network is composed of in-person and virtual therapists, physicians, and coaches across the US. With our advanced matching technology, supportive provider platform, and opportunities for training and clinical consultation, being part of our network is an incredible chance to do what you love (like patient care) with support for the things you don’t love (like self promotion and scheduling).

We are looking for contract psychiatrists who are passionate about whole-person, whole family mental health care and working within a connected network to provide patients with easily accessible, culturally responsive, high-quality mental health care.

As a contract psychiatrist, you’ll provide evidence-based treatment via live 60-minute video intake appointments and regular follow-up appointments. You’ll conduct psychiatric evaluations and provide medication management. Lyra makes it easy to refer patients to evidence-based therapy and coaching services in tandem with your care.

You will provide care to individuals from a multitude of different backgrounds and experiences, as well as those with varying needs and abilities. We strive to continue to meet their unique needs by delivering culturally-responsive care—an approach that is mindful of the impact of cultural background on each person’s care experience.

Responsibilities:

  • Clinical Assessment and Diagnostic Skills - Conduct comprehensive psychiatric evaluations, formulate accurate diagnoses, and create individualized treatment plans tailored to each developmental stage.
  • Evidence-Based Treatment - Utilize proven therapeutic techniques and medication management strategies to address conditions such as anxiety, depression, ADHD, and mood disorders, ensuring safe and appropriate interventions.
  • Family-Centered Approach - Foster a collaborative treatment environment, educating families on mental health issues, involving them in care planning, and providing guidance on supportive measures at home.
  • Virtual Care Delivery - Conduct virtual psychiatric sessions, ensuring a high-quality and supportive experience, and leverage technology to maintain regular communication with members and families.
  • Collaborative Teamwork - Actively participate in team meetings, contribute to collaborative care planning, and provide consultative support to other team members for comprehensive member care.
  • Data-Driven Practice and Documentation - Maintain accurate, timely documentation of assessments, care plans, and progress notes. Use data analytics to assess outcomes and continuously improve care quality.
  • Ethics and Compliance - Ensure compliance with all regulatory and quality standards, engage in ongoing professional development, and commit to ethical, patient-centered care practices.

Requirements:

  • Board-certified or -eligible Child and Adolescent Psychiatrist with an active license in at least one state
  • Experience providing telehealth therapy services in a virtual environment (video and teletherapy) preferred but not required
  • Computer and live video tools literacy (e.g., Zoom, Google Meets, DoxyMe, Skype, etc.)
  • Demonstrated family engagement skills and experience working with children, adolescents, and young adults
  • Commitment to and familiarity with JCAHO guidelines and competency in practicing within an accredited framework to ensure safety, quality, and compliance
